Use este identificador para citar ou linkar para este item: http://repositorio.utfpr.edu.br/jspui/handle/1/5451
Registro completo de metadados
Campo DCValorIdioma
dc.creatorSouza, Mariana Karina Miglionari de-
dc.date.accessioned2020-11-03T19:33:24Z-
dc.date.available5000-
dc.date.available2020-11-03T19:33:24Z-
dc.date.issued2020-08-05-
dc.identifier.citationSOUZA, Mariana Karina Miglionari de. Investigando o teste exploratório para aplicações móveis. 2020. Dissertação (Mestrado em Informática) - Universidade Tecnológica Federal do Paraná, Cornélio Procópio, 2020.pt_BR
dc.identifier.urihttp://repositorio.utfpr.edu.br/jspui/handle/1/5451-
dc.description.abstractFrom the 1990s, mobile devices started to emerge, such as smartphones, tablets and e-readers. These devices contain mobile applications, which are briefly called apps. There are a variety of users who use such devices, and consequently make use of apps in their daily lives; therefore, they should not have problems that hinder the user experience. To decrease the incidence of failures in such apps, tests are applied during the Software Engineering process. A technique widely used by the industry is Exploratory Testing (ET), a manual testing approach that dismisses the use of scripts, leading the tester to use his own knowledge and creativity to conduct the tests. In this way, the tester uses his practices and skills, relying less on documentation. The aim of this work is to investigate the use of ET in apps. Specifically, an exploratory study was conducted with several apps, and an experiment was conducted with professionals. The exploratory study was divided into two stages. The first step consisted of testing open source apps and the second one with apps developed by a development company. Based on the obtained results, an extension to the ET was proposed to include an opportunity map (OM). OM is a mental map of scenarios that can be explored for a specific app. In the experiment with professionals, the ET using OM was compared with the traditional ET. We observed positive results regarding the effectiveness of ET in mobile apps. In addition, the experiment revealed that it is possible to make refinements to make ET more effective in detecting bugs. When adopting the OM, the results showed that it detects more bugs and of different types when compared with the traditional ET.pt_BR
dc.languageporpt_BR
dc.publisherUniversidade Tecnológica Federal do Paranápt_BR
dc.rightsembargoedAccesspt_BR
dc.subjectSoftware - Testespt_BR
dc.subjectAndroid (Recurso eletrônico)pt_BR
dc.subjectAplicativos móveispt_BR
dc.subjectComputer software - Testingpt_BR
dc.subjectAndroid (Electronic resource)pt_BR
dc.subjectMobile appspt_BR
dc.titleInvestigando o teste exploratório para aplicações móveispt_BR
dc.typemasterThesispt_BR
dc.description.resumoA partir dos anos 90, os dispositivos móveis começaram a surgir, como smartphones, tablets e e-readers. Esses dispositivos contem aplicações móveis, que são brevemente chamadas de apps. Ha uma diversidade de usuários que utilizam tais dispositivos e consequentemente fazem uso das apps em seu dia-a-dia; portanto elas não devem apresentar problemas que atrapalhem a experiência do usuário. Para diminuir a incidência de defeitos em tais apps, são aplicados testes durante o processo de Engenharia de Software. Uma técnica muito utilizada pela indústria e o Teste Exploratório (TE), uma abordagem de teste manual que dispensa o uso de scripts, conduzindo o testador a utilizar seu próprio conhecimento e criatividade para conduzir os testes. Desta forma, o testador utiliza suas praticas e habilidades, contando com menor dependência da documentação. O objetivo deste trabalho e investigar a utilização do TE em apps. Especificamente, foi realizado um estudo exploratório com diversas apps, e um experimento que foi conduzido com profissionais da área. O estudo exploratório foi dividido em duas etapas. A primeira etapa consistiu em testar apps open source e a segunda apps desenvolvidas por uma empresa de desenvolvimento. Com base nos resultados obtidos, foi proposta uma extensão ao TE para incluir um mapa de oportunidades (MO). O MO ˜ e um mapa mental de cenários que se pode explorar referente a uma app em especifico. No experimento com profissionais, o TE usando MO foi comparado com o TE tradicional. Foi possível observar resultados positivos em relação a efetividade do TE em apps móveis, ou seja o quanto esta abordagem alcançara os objetivos que lhe foram empregados (KLEINSORGE, 2015). Além disso, o experimento revelou que e possível realizar refinamentos a fim de tornar o TE mais efetivo na detecção de bugs. Ao adotar o MO, os resultados apontaram que este detecta mais bugs e de diferentes tipos se comparado com o TE tradicional.pt_BR
dc.degree.localCornélio Procópiopt_BR
dc.publisher.localCornelio Procopiopt_BR
dc.creator.Latteshttp://lattes.cnpq.br/5095236921885393pt_BR
dc.contributor.advisor1Endo, Andre Takeshi-
dc.contributor.advisor1Latteshttp://lattes.cnpq.br/4221336619791961pt_BR
dc.contributor.referee1Endo, Andre Takeshi-
dc.contributor.referee1Latteshttp://lattes.cnpq.br/4221336619791961pt_BR
dc.contributor.referee2Oliveira Junior, Edson Alves de-
dc.contributor.referee2Latteshttp://lattes.cnpq.br/8717980588591239pt_BR
dc.contributor.referee3Souza, Erica Ferreira de-
dc.contributor.referee3Latteshttp://lattes.cnpq.br/8904855809524041pt_BR
dc.publisher.countryBrasilpt_BR
dc.publisher.programPrograma de Pós-Graduação em Informáticapt_BR
dc.publisher.initialsUTFPRpt_BR
dc.subject.cnpqCN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AOpt_BR
dc.subject.capesCiência da Computaçãopt_BR
Aparece nas coleções:CP - Programa de Pós-Graduação em Informática

Arquivos associados a este item:
Arquivo Descrição TamanhoFormato 
CP_PPGI_M_Souza,_Mariana_Karina_Miglionari_2020.pdf
  Disponível a partir de 5000-01-01
3,01 MBAdobe PDFVisualizar/Abrir Solicitar uma cópia


Os itens no repositório estão protegidos por copyright, com todos os direitos reservados, salvo quando é indicado o contrário.